How many amps is A USB wall charger?

In the USB 1.0 and 2.0 specs, a standard downstream port is capable of delivering up to 500mA (0.5A); with USB 3.0, it moves up to 900mA (0.9A). The charging downstream and dedicated charging ports provide up to 1,500mA (1.5A).

How does a USB 2.0 wall charger negotiate current output?

Usual wall (and BC1.1/1.2) chargers do not negotiate anything. They only “advertise” their capability by means of some signature on D+/D- wires. It is the DEVICE that decides to take maximum necessary current based on detected signature and the state of internal battery.

What’s the maximum current a USB charger can draw?

So it can try to draw up to 1.5 A, but if the charger voltage drops below 2 V at 0.5 A, then you can’t draw any more than 0.5 A from it. For a dedicated charger or USB charger, the current limit is determined by loading the adapter.
